POSITION TITLE: Assistant Merchant
POSITION SUMMARY
Responsible for working with the Merchant in the implementation and execution of strategies to drive a compelling and holistic assortment for the AEO Brand. The Assistant Merchant is expected to execute the vision of the leadership team while servicing the American Eagle Outfitters customer. They intuitively respond to sales and market trends to propose actions that drive category specific growth and increased profitability. A passion for trend, strong attention to detail, ability to thrive in a fast paced business, and entrepreneurial spirit are key characteristics for success.
RESPONSIBILITIES
Analyze business and deliver recommendations to drive sales and margin growth on a weekly, monthly, and quarterly basis. Utilize sales history to aid Merchant in identifying product opportunities in the assortment. Partner with Planning and Inventory Planning to pull all necessary analysis required for weekly sales recapping, as well as product meetings. Own on order and shipping; work closely with Planning, Inventory Planning, Production, and Transportation to ensure all product receipts timely and as planned. Understand (at all times) Brick and Mortar and Digital marketplace and competition. Have a strong point of view regarding trend, product placement, pricing, and marketing. Take ownership of product information for every style bought, asserting oneself as the expert of details. Quickly identify and adapt to changes and trends occurring in the business. Organize and create a systematic method for managing all sample areas. Partner with Production, Design, Business Strategies, Visual Merchandising, and the Photo Studio to ensure all samples are where they need to be at all times. Manage all PO’s – Own attributing and information pass off to MOS and Inventory Planning teams to ensure orders are written accurately and timely. Maintain understanding of total AE Business, tracking assortment strategies, current and past sales performance, and opportunities for growth.
